Look for low levels around your property, paying special attention to the areas around your home’s foundation. These low areas can be packed with compacted soil so water no longer pools and erodes yards. This water can seep into the house, rotting out wood.

Stay balanced! Diminish the noises inside your house. A wobbling, noisy ceiling fan usually just needs to be balanced. Sometimes, all that is necessary is simple adjustment of the screws that hold the blades onto the blade holders. Also, tighten any screws that hold the blade holders to the motor. When adjusting the screws, make sure that all parts of your fan are thoroughly clean.

Any plumbing and wiring issues should be addressed first when doing any home improvement projects. Doing work in a logical order, such as doing projects that require you to access the inside of your walls first, will help your project flow without a glitch. Additionally, it’s much easier and less costly to get your plumbing and electrical maintentance done when walls are already torn open.

An ugly outdoor air conditioner can be an eyesore, but it is necessary in certain regions. You can hide this with a trellis or latticework if you want to. Ornamental grasses are a great option, but you must make sure you leave about one foot between the edge of your unit and the roots.
